本文目录导读:
随着互联网技术的飞速发展,越来越多的企业开始关注用户体验,试用网站作为一种新型的营销手段,越来越受到企业的青睐,本文将深入解析试用网站源码,带您了解其架构与实现细节。
试用网站概述
试用网站是指企业为了推广产品或服务,提供一定期限的免费试用,让用户在体验过程中了解产品或服务的优势,试用网站通常包括以下功能模块:
1、用户注册与登录:用户通过注册账号,登录系统,享受免费试用服务。
2、产品展示:展示试用产品的详细信息,包括图片、文字、参数等。
图片来源于网络,如有侵权联系删除
3、试用申请:用户填写申请表,提交试用申请。
4、试用反馈:用户在试用结束后,对产品或服务进行评价和反馈。
5、数据统计与分析:对用户试用数据进行统计和分析,为企业提供决策依据。
试用网站架构
试用网站采用前后端分离的架构,前端负责页面展示和用户交互,后端负责数据处理和业务逻辑。
1、前端架构
前端采用Vue.js框架,实现响应式布局和单页面应用(SPA),以下是前端架构的主要组成部分:
(1)Vue.js:核心框架,负责页面渲染和组件管理。
(2)Element UI:基于Vue.js的UI组件库,提供丰富的UI元素。
(3)Axios:基于Promise的HTTP客户端,用于前后端数据交互。
图片来源于网络,如有侵权联系删除
2、后端架构
后端采用Node.js框架,实现RESTful API,以下是后端架构的主要组成部分:
(1)Express:基于Node.js的Web应用框架,用于搭建RESTful API。
(2)Mongoose:用于MongoDB数据库的ORM工具,简化数据库操作。
(3)Redis:高性能的键值对存储系统,用于缓存和分布式锁。
实现细节
1、用户注册与登录
用户注册时,前端收集用户信息,通过Axios发送请求到后端API,后端验证信息并存储到数据库,登录时,用户输入账号和密码,前端发送请求到后端API,后端验证信息并返回Token。
2、产品展示
产品展示页面通过Axios向后端API请求产品信息,后端从数据库中查询数据并返回给前端,前端使用Vue.js渲染页面。
图片来源于网络,如有侵权联系删除
3、试用申请
用户填写申请表后,前端将数据发送到后端API,后端验证信息并存储到数据库。
4、试用反馈
用户在试用结束后,填写反馈表单,前端将数据发送到后端API,后端存储到数据库。
5、数据统计与分析
后端通过Mongoose查询数据库,获取用户试用数据,使用统计工具进行分析,并将结果返回给前端。
本文深入解析了试用网站源码,从架构和实现细节两方面进行了详细阐述,了解试用网站源码有助于我们更好地理解其工作原理,为后续开发、优化和维护提供参考,在实际应用中,可以根据企业需求,对试用网站进行功能扩展和优化,提升用户体验。
标签: #试用网站 源码
评论列表